How they compare
Oman currently reports 10,066 t against 9,325 t in Italy, a difference of 741 t.
That makes Oman's figure about 1.1 times Italy's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 12 shared years of data; in 2009 it was Italy ahead.
Italy ranks 28th and Oman ranks 27th of 108 countries.
Italy has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

About this data
The Fertilizers by Product dataset contains information on the Production, Trade and Agriculture Use of inorganic (chemical or mineral) fertilizers products. The fertilizer statistics data are for a set of 23 product categories. Both straight and compound fertilizers are included.
